🏰 What to see in South Haven
Discover the charm and history of South Haven by exploring its iconic landmarks and scenic spots. From historic lighthouses to vibrant gardens, each sight offers a unique glimpse into the town's rich heritage.
-
South Haven Lighthouse
A picturesque red lighthouse overlooking Lake Michigan, offering stunning views and a perfect spot for sunset photography.
-
Kal-Haven Trail State Park
A scenic trail that stretches for 34 miles, passing through lush forests, charming towns, and offering opportunities for hiking, biking, and birdwatching.
-
Van Buren State Park
A beautiful beachfront park with towering dunes, sandy beaches, and clear waters, ideal for swimming, sunbathing, and picnicking.
-
Liberty Hyde Bailey Museum
A historic house museum celebrating the life and work of renowned horticulturist Liberty Hyde Bailey, showcasing beautiful gardens and Victorian architecture.
-
Warner Vineyards
Visit one of Michigan's oldest wineries, Warner Vineyards, for tastings of award-winning wines, tours of vineyards, and insights into the art of winemaking.

🚍 Getting Around South Haven
-
Public Transport
South Haven offers limited public transportation options. The South Haven Area Regional Transit (SHART) operates a bus service covering key areas in the town. The buses are clean, safe, and affordable with a one-way fare of $1.50. The bus schedule is available on the SHART website or at designated bus stops around town.
-
Main Transportation Hubs
For those traveling to South Haven by train, the closest Amtrak station is in Bangor, approximately 20 minutes away by car. The nearest bus terminal is the South Haven Visitors Bureau, located downtown near the waterfront. South Haven does not have its own airport; the closest major airport is Gerald R. Ford International Airport in Grand Rapids, about a 2-hour drive away.
-
Rental Services
🚗 Car Rentals: Visitors can rent a car from national chains like Enterprise or Hertz, with prices starting at $40 per day. These rental services offer a range of vehicle options to suit different needs. 🚲 Bicycle Rentals: For a more eco-friendly way to explore South Haven, bicycle rentals are available from places like Rock 'n' Road Cycle. Prices typically start at $15 per day and include a helmet and bike lock. Cycling around town is a popular and enjoyable way to see the sights at a leisurely pace.
